Abstract

This paper examines the key issues involved in choosing synchronization techniques applicable to both terrestrial and satellite switching networks. The terrestrial networks considered involve circuit switching, message switching, packet switching, and other integrated voice/data nodal configurations. The satellite networks considered involve time-division multiple access (TDMA) systems and their associated synchronization problems. Peculiar problems associated with satelliteswitched TDMA (SS/TDMA) network synchronization are also addressed. Finally, the issues involved in synchronizing integrated satellite/terrestrial networks are addressed. Emphasis will be placed on assessing the state of the art of current terrestial/satellite synchronization technology and projecting future trends.
